Woman to plead guilty in plot to sell Elvis Presley’s Graceland home
A woman said she is pleading guilty to a federal charge accusing her of concocting a brazen plot to defraud Elvis Presley’s family by trying to auction off his Graceland mansion and property before a judge halted the mysterious foreclosure sale.
During a change of plea hearing, Lisa Jeanine Findley told a federal judge in Memphis that she will plead guilty to a charge of mail fraud related to the scheme.
